Key words/phrases for this half term are: Week 1 - Hasta luego. See you soon. Week 2 - Gracias. Thank you. Week 3 - Por favor. Please. Week 4 - Abrid la puerta. Open the door. Week 5 - Cerrad la puerta. Close the door. Week 6 - Silencio, por favor. Silence, please. Week 7 - Feliz Navidad. Happy Christmas! In Spanish lessons, Year 4 have been learning how to describe...
